Output e16bd1dc77d2662b6f61bcfa90eea6026d59b1c9c1594deaa416fc76184dc471:0

value
284375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ec885fc22a52b69bae83290b849e1ed6204784 OP_EQUAL
address
31xUdWSBmJ8H72BSFaKUwGTnH9LbWiVDRk
transaction
e16bd1dc77d2662b6f61bcfa90eea6026d59b1c9c1594deaa416fc76184dc471
confirmations
308598
spent
true